2025 NCAA runner up in the women’s 200 breaststroke Mackenzie Miller will transfer to Fresno State for the upcoming 2025-2026 season. Miller spent the last three seasons at BYU.
Miller will travel closer to home as she is originally from Sanger, California. Sanger is only a 20 minute drive from Fresno State’s campus.
This past March, Miller scored all 29 points for BYU at the 2025 NCAA Championships. She finished 2nd in the 200 breaststroke with a 2:05.03 as well as 7th in the 100 breast with a 58.39. She was slightly faster in prelims of the 100 breast with a 58.14. She made huge strides this past season as she had never broken 1:00 in the 100 breast and the 2:10 mark in the 200 breast prior to this past season.
Miller’s Best SCY Times:
- 100 breast: 58.14
- 200 breast: 2:05.03
- 200 IM: 1:57.62
The Fresno State women were 3rd out of 10 teams at the 2025 Mountain West Conference. The team went on to finish 43rd at 2025 NCAAs and had two individual swimmers qualify for the meet. Rising senior Aliz Kalmar swam to a 16th place finish in the 200 breast with a 2:09.17. That made her Fresno State’s first All-American in program history.
Miller is a huge pick up for Fresno State and will have the chance to train alongside Kalmar as the two are in their senior seasons. The two have the potential to make history this upcoming season and could become All-Americans together. Jenna Pulkkinen also swam in the breaststroke events at 2025 NCAAs as she was 27th in the 100 breast (59.45) and 35th in the 200 breast (2:10.85). Pulkkinen just finished her sophomore season.
